Meanwhile Martin Laursen, who is surely at the top of list of candidates to become Villa captain, has told the official site he believes Martin O’Neill will bring in the right quality players for the new season. ‘Obviously we need a lot of new players because we’ve lost a few this summer. We definitely need some quantity and a lot of quality as well. I’m sure that the manager will bring in good players, so I’m not worried about that. It would be nice to get them as soon as possible so that we can build up a team but I understand it’s not that easy. We want to try and take the best players. We want quality and quality players are not easy to get and you need to work a lot for them.’

Marlon Harewood also says that the arrival of Steve Sidwell from Chelsea proves that Villa mean business. On the chances of breaking into the top four he says ‘Anything is possible. If we can get a team together with good team spirit, the lads start performing then anything can happen. We had a small squad last year and we did really well. I think Martin will be trying to work on that and get more players in and hopefully he does that. If we get players like that in then you never know.’

The Hare has also spoken about this weeks Intertoto game (on Setanta Sports) and says ‘It’s a great opportunity for Villa to get into Europe but we can’t enter the game thinking like that.’

Stiliyan Petrov meanwhile says that the pressure will increase on Villa next season. Again on the official site that they played well last season and to improve have to play even better for this coming one. ‘That is about more expectation and it is a lot of pressure. But I think we’re all ready to handle that pressure.’ He is also looking to imrove personally, ‘Of course that’s my aim, to be consistent, but people saw last season that even when I wasn’t playing I never gave up – and I won’t. I have still got two years left on my contract, I will try to play as much as I can and try to help the team as much as I can with my ability. At the end of the day, what is more important is the team effort and how we play as a team, because last season we stayed together as a team and we achieved a lot.’

Sky Sports News quote Slavia Prague defender Marek Suchy claiming there are a few clubs chasing him. He says he spoke to his agent last week and was told ‘the interest is still there. But Slavia have not received a specific offer. That’s the problem.’ And on possible destinations he denied links to Everton and Rangers and added, ‘No, also other clubs from the Premier League – Newcastle and Aston Villa.’

Martin Laursen has warned his team mates that Odense BK will not be passengers in the Inter two legged game. ‘It’s very early to play competitive football but we have to be ready for the two games against Odense. We want to play in the UEFA Cup and we have to be ready. It’s almost impossible to be 100 per cent fit just yet but they will not be 100 per cent fit either. So it’s going to be exciting. Odense are a good team – one of the best in Denmark. As well as Thomas Helveg they’ve got some international players, so it’s not going to be easy.’
